    Certainly not. Losing to a couple of the division's elite is no reason to stick your head in the sand.

    I would favor Trout over half the current world titlists at 154lbs. (Molina and the winner of Andrade vs. Rose - which is most probably Andrade...)

    He would be a handful or stumbling block for most of the up-and-comers, as well, including Nelson and even the Charlo kids.

    Trout vs. Martirosyan in a rematch of their Olympic trials meet in 2004 would be a great, 50-50 match-up and would produce a worthy contender for any of the belts.

    Trout is still plenty relevant and has plenty left to accomplish if he so chooses and stays as motivated and fit as he was on his quiet rise up (which, remember, came through hard work and devoid of the benefit of major promotional backing or American TV exposure until very late into his career...)
